Abstract

PURPOSE:To provide a deodorant composition effective for removing the smell generated from the cigarette end discarded in an ash tray, by impregnating a carrier composed of an inorg. porous absorptive material with an aqueous formaldehyde solution. CONSTITUTION:A carrier composed of an inorg. porous adsorptive material is impregnated with a aqueous formaldehyde solution. As the inorg. porous adsorptive material, there are natural and synthetic zeolite or a silica gel. The concn. of the aqueous formaldehyde solution to be used is pref. 4wt.% or less and the impregnation amount thereof into the carrier composed of the porous adsorptive material is pref. the absorbing saturation limit amount of the carrier or less. The high concn. aqueous formaldehyde solution with concn. of 4wt.% or more can be used but, in this case, it is not pref. since a formaldehyde smell is generated from a deodorant composition.

DETAILED DESCRIPTION OF THE INVENTION [Field of Industrial Application] The present invention relates to a deodorant composition for eliminating cigarette odors generated from cigarette butts discarded in ashtrays in cigarette smoking areas.

Conventionally, filling ashtrays with water in smoking areas of various buildings has been widely used as a countermeasure against smoking, particularly as a countermeasure against cigarette butts. In order to improve the appearance of hotel lobbies, waiting rooms, and other areas where a large number of people come and go each year, large ashtrays are lined with crushed rocks. All of these conventional smoking countermeasures using ashtrays are aimed at preventing fires, that is, extinguishing fires.

If you leave an ashtray with cigarette butts in it after smoking in a place where a lot of people smoke, such as a meeting room, for example, until the next morning, you will smell a strong smell of cigarettes when you enter the room. It is well known that there are things that can be felt.

However, the above-mentioned ashtray filled with water or crushed stone cannot eliminate the cigarette smell.

The use of air fresheners has been proposed as a means of eliminating such cigarette odors, but this method involves diluting the cigarette odor with a mixing tool with the fragrance of the air freshener, which is stronger than the cigarette odor. It is no different than fooling the sense of smell with other aromas, and does not eliminate the cigarette smell itself.

Another possible method for preventing fires is to line the ashtray with a nonflammable material that absorbs and eliminates cigarette odor, such as zeolite or silica gel.

It has been found that the deodorizing effect of the above-mentioned method using a substance that absorbs cigarette odor is not sufficient, as shown in the reference examples described below.

Accordingly, an object of the present invention is to provide a deodorant composition that is effective in eliminating odors generated from cigarette butts discarded in ashtrays.

The present invention resides in a cigarette odor deodorant composition in which a carrier made of an inorganic porous adsorbent material is impregnated with an aqueous solution of formaldehyde.

Examples of inorganic porous adsorptive materials that can be used in the present invention include natural and synthetic zeolites or silica gels. The concentration of the aqueous formaldehyde solution used is preferably 4% by weight or less, and the amount of porous adsorbent material impregnated into the carrier is preferably less than the absorption saturation limit of the carrier.

Although it is possible to use an aqueous solution with a formaldehyde concentration higher than 4% by weight, this is not preferred because the deodorant composition will emit a formaldehyde odor. In addition, if the carrier is impregnated with a formaldehyde aqueous solution in an amount exceeding the absorption saturation limit of the carrier, the formaldehyde aqueous solution may ooze out from the carrier, dissolving and exuding brown tar from cigarette butts, which may stain the ashtray itself, so this is not preferred. do not have.

It is also possible to use acetaldehyde, which is similar to formaldehyde, in place of formaldehyde, but in this case, the carrier must be impregnated with a formaldehyde aqueous solution at a high concentration and in large quantities, and it is also possible to remove the cigarette odor caused by cigarette butts. It was found that this was not desirable because it produced an acetic acid odor.

According to the present invention, when a smoked cigarette butt is pushed into an ashtray lined with a carrier made of an inorganic porous adsorbent material impregnated with formalin drippings, the foul smell of tobacco that comes from the cigarette butt after extinguishing the fire does not occur; It is also possible to prevent the generation of cigarette odor from the butts protruding from the carrier layer.

The reason why the porous adsorptive material carrier impregnated with the formaldehyde aqueous solution mentioned above eliminates the cigarette odor caused by cigarette butts is not known for sure, but it is probably due to a combination of the reducing action of formaldehyde and the adsorption properties of the carrier itself. It is thought to deodorize the cigarette smell.

Example 1 In an ashtray with an inner diameter of 5G, various concentrations shown in Table 1 below were applied to each 10y of calcined natural zeolite from Shiroishi, Miyagi Prefecture (trade name Zeofive, manufactured by Gochi Co., Ltd.) as an inorganic adsorptive material having micropores. of formaldehyde aqueous solution
Each 1w1t of impregnated material was added, and 5 cigarette butts (half-smoked) were pushed in each to extinguish the fire.

For each ashtray, before use, i.e., just before extinguishing the water, the formalin water of the deodorizer, the smell of cigarette tar immediately after extinguishing five cigarettes,
Table 1 shows the results of testing for cigarette tar odor after 24 hours.

Table 1 From the results in Table 1, it can be seen that when the concentration of the formaldehyde aqueous solution is up to 3%, there is no formaldehyde odor at all, and the cigarette tar odor is eliminated immediately after use and even after 24 hours, indicating that it has an excellent deodorizing effect. In the case of the 4-chi concentration, a slight formaldehyde odor was felt before use, but it was weak, and it was found that when a small amount of fragrance was added as a masking agent, the odor was masked and could not be detected. Example 2 Each 10y of Zeofive was impregnated with a small amount of natural rose perfume oil as a flavoring agent and a 4T formaldehyde aqueous solution in the amount shown in Table 2 below, and placed in an ashtray with an inner diameter of 5α.
Smoked cigarettes (half smoked) in each ashtray
was pushed in to extinguish the fire. The number of cigarette butts until the smell of cigarette tar was detected was then measured.

In addition, the smell of cigarette tar was also examined 24 hours after each test. The results are shown in Table 2. In Table 2, when formaldehyde aqueous solution s mt was used, a brown exudate was observed at the bottom of the ashtray after 24 hours, and the cigarette tar odor was completely eliminated. Since this was not possible, it was found that it is not preferable to exceed the absorption saturation limit of the carrier.

Reference Example 1 Table 3 shows the results of repeating Example 1 using acetaldehyde aqueous solutions having the concentrations shown in Table 5 below instead of the formaldehyde aqueous solution in Example 1.

Table 3 The results in Table 3 show that aqueous solutions of acetaldehyde, which is similar to formaldehyde, were not able to sufficiently deodorize cigarette tar odor (especially immediately after putting in the butts), and that the 10% and 8% concentrations after 24 hours had a deodorizing effect. In this case, it was found that the odor of acetic acid was emitted, which was not desirable.

When I pushed cigarette butts into this, I was able to get rid of the smell of cigarette butts up to six butts, but I couldn't get rid of the smell of cigarette butts beyond that.

As is clear from the data of the above examples, the deodorant composition according to the present invention is effective in deodorizing the cigarette tar odor emitted from cigarette butts remaining in the ashtray for a long period of time until the ashtray is cleaned. It is effective for For this reason, it is used not only for small ashtrays for personal use at home, but also for large ashtrays in offices, conference rooms, hotel rooms, lobbies, and other places where an unspecified number of people come and go, as well as ashtrays in cars. It has an excellent effect of being easy and simple to use and deodorizing it.
